Transaction 58c523ca5305dfff12907bbbb8a253b2a0a249372b2bc5a7ac7560c67c3eb37f

1 Input
2 Outputs
  • 58c523ca5305dfff12907bbbb8a253b2a0a249372b2bc5a7ac7560c67c3eb37f:0
  • value  10290
    address  1Ezc6EAP5qN2TpCDBahZeQxgFM6SXV9dfy
  • 58c523ca5305dfff12907bbbb8a253b2a0a249372b2bc5a7ac7560c67c3eb37f:1
  • value  438206
    address  32n6E97wYp2BX8LCW2Nz24k2okzDYX42k3